1.1     ! root        1: /* Copyright 1985, Massachusetts Institute of Technology */
        !             2: 
        !             3: /* put.c       Perform a raster operation with a source bitmap
        !             4:  *
        !             5:  *     PixmapPut       Puts a pixmap up on the screen
        !             6:  *     PixmapBitsPut   Puts a pixmap up on the screen
        !             7:  *     BitmapBitsPut   Puts a pixmap up on the screen
        !             8:  *
        !             9:  * Modification History:
        !            10:  *
        !            11:  *   Carver 8601.13 Added extern statement for SSmap
        !            12:  *
        !            13:  *   Carver 8601.06 Added line to PixmapPut to adjust the func to compensate
        !            14:  *                 for the reverse flag being set in the pixmap descriptor.
        !            15:  *
        !            16:  *   Carver 8510.10 Put in support for source bitmap/sub-bitmap mask
        !            17:  *                 copy areas.
        !            18:  *
        !            19:  *   Carver 8510.09 In PixmapBitsPut fixed the table lookup on foreground
        !            20:  *                 and background.
        !            21:  */
        !            22: 
        !            23: #include "ddxqvss.h"
        !            24: #include "vstagbl.h"
        !            25: 
        !            26: extern BITMAP pbm;
        !            27: 
        !            28: PixmapPut (src, srcx, srcy, width, height, dstx, dsty, clips, clipcount,
        !            29:           func, zmask)
        !            30:        register PIXMAP *src;
        !            31:        int srcx, srcy, width, height, dstx, dsty, clipcount, zmask;
        !            32:        register int func;
        !            33:        CLIP *clips;
        !            34: {
        !            35:        BITMAP *bm = (BITMAP *) src->data;
        !            36:        extern char SSMap[];
        !            37: 
        !            38:        if (!(zmask & 1))  return;
        !            39: 
        !            40:        /* ADJUST MAP FOR REVERSE PIXMAP */
        !            41: 
        !            42:        func = SSMap[ func | (src->kind & InvertFlag)];
        !            43: 
        !            44:        copyrmsk( VSTA$K_SRC_BITMAP, (short *)bm->data, bm->width, bm->height,
        !            45:                srcx, srcy, width, height, 
        !            46:                (short *)pbm.data, pbm.width, pbm.height,
        !            47:                dstx, dsty, func, clipcount, clips);
        !            48:        return;
        !            49: }
        !            50: 
        !            51: 
        !            52: /*ARGSUSED*/
        !            53: PixmapBitsPut (width, height, format, data, xymask, dstx, dsty,
        !            54:               clips, clipcount, func, zmask)
        !            55:        char *data;
        !            56:        int width, height, format, dstx, dsty, clipcount, zmask;
        !            57:        BITMAP *xymask;
        !            58:        CLIP *clips;
        !            59:        int func;
        !            60: {
        !            61:        BitmapBitsPut (width, height, data, 1, 0, xymask, dstx, dsty,
        !            62:                       clips, clipcount, func, zmask);
        !            63: }
        !            64: 
        !            65: 
        !            66: BitmapBitsPut (width, height, data, fore, back, xymask, dstx, dsty,
        !            67:               clips, clipcount, func, zmask)
        !            68:        char *data;
        !            69:        int width, height, fore, back, dstx, dsty, clipcount, zmask;
        !            70:        register BITMAP *xymask;
        !            71:        CLIP *clips;
        !            72:        register int func;
        !            73: {
        !            74:        int mask_x = pbm.width, mask_y = pbm.height;
        !            75:        extern char FBMap[];
        !            76: 
        !            77:        if (!(zmask & 1))  return;
        !            78: 
        !            79:        /* USE FBMap TABLE TO CONVERT FORE/BACK INTO A SINGLE SOURCE
        !            80:           MAPPING FUNCTION */
        !            81: 
        !            82:        if (fore & 1) func += 0x20;
        !            83:        if (back & 1) func += 0x10;
        !            84: 
        !            85:        func = FBMap[func];
        !            86: 
        !            87:        if (xymask == NULL) 
        !            88:                {
        !            89:                copyrmsk (VSTA$K_SRC_BITMAP, (short *) data, width, height,
        !            90:                          0, 0, mask_x, mask_y, (short *) pbm.data, pbm.width,
        !            91:                          pbm.height, dstx, dsty, func, clipcount, clips);
        !            92:                }
        !            93:        else
        !            94:                {
        !            95:                        
        !            96:                copybmsk (
        !            97:                        VSTA$K_SRC_BITMAP, (short *)data, width, height, 
        !            98:                        0, 0, 
        !            99:                        (short *) xymask->data, xymask->width, xymask->height,
        !           100:                        0, 0, width, height,
        !           101:                        (short *)pbm.data, pbm.width, pbm.height,
        !           102:                        dstx, dsty, func, clipcount, clips);
        !           103:                };
        !           104: 
        !           105: 
        !           106: 
        !           107:        return;
        !           108: }
